NEXT Campus Launches South Asia’s First Bachelor’s Degree in Airline, Airport, and Aviation Management

NEXT Campus, Colombo proudly announced the launch of South Asia’s first Bachelor’s Degree in Airline, Airport, and Aviation Management, awarded by London Metropolitan University, bringing globally recognised aviation education to
Sri Lanka and the wider region.

The official launch was marked on 25 February 2026 when NEXT Campus hosted a specially curated Aviation Day at the Lakshman Kadirgamar Institute. The event comprised of the inauguration and orientation of the BSc (Hons) Airline, Airport and Aviation Management degree programme, followed by networking among industry professionals, academics, aviation experts, alumni, parents, and newly enrolled students.

The ceremony was graced by Chief Guest Sunil Jayarathne, Chairman of the Civil Aviation Authority of Sri Lanka, alongside leading aviation veterans and global industry representatives.

This landmark initiative represents a major milestone in higher education in South Asia, introducing the first-ever, comprehensive three-year specialised aviation management degree offered locally. The programme addresses a long-standing gap in structured aviation education while supporting the development of highly skilled professionals required for the future expansion of the global aviation industry.

Delivering the keynote address, Dr. Dusty Alahakoon, Founder and Chairman of NEXT Campus, shared his vision under the theme “Shaping the Future of Aviation Education,” highlighting how international academic collaboration and industry integration will redefine aviation education standards in Sri Lanka.

Addressing the gathering, Chief Guest Mr. Sunil Jayarathne emphasised the growing importance of academically trained aviation professionals in ensuring safety, regulatory compliance, and operational excellence within both local and international aviation sectors.

The event was further honoured by the presence of ICAO Global Ambassadors Prabath Kularathne (also the Head of Promotions of the Civil Aviation Authority, Sri Lanka) and Dr.

Upuli Warnakula who shared valuable industry insights with students and parents, highlighting emerging global aviation opportunities and career pathways.

The internationally accredited BSc (Hons) Airline, Airport and Aviation Management programme is carefully designed to develop future aviation leaders equipped with industry-relevant knowledge, operational competencies, and global career readiness. The curriculum integrates academic excellence with practical exposure aligned with international aviation standards, preparing graduates to meet the demands of a rapidly evolving aviation landscape.

Through this pioneering initiative, NEXT Campus strengthens Sri Lanka’s position as an emerging regional hub for aviation education and professional development, opening new pathways for students to pursue global careers in airline operations, airport management, aviation safety, and
air transport management.
